I have solved a lot of fixed seal leaks (not just cars) with that blue gasket maker. That O ring dipstick is a pretty wimpy design, if the tube gets a little out of line. I solved that by using late 70s dipstick sets, which use a rubber funnel into the trans, a set retrofits fine. Bruce Roe
